have on
verb
- to have incriminating evidence about.
What do the feds have on you?

have one foot in the grave
verb
- to be near death.
He looks like he has one foot in the grave.

have (one) like
verb
- to make one feel like, look like, resemble, etc. Usually used in electronic communication, and usually followed by an image such as a photo or a meme.
Mornings got me like

have (one's) back
verb
- to look out for one's interests or well-being.
Nobody has my back.

have (one's) head up (one's) ass
verb
- to be ignorant.
- See more words with the same meaning: unintelligent, dumb.
Last edited on May 26 2013. Submitted by Walter Rader (Editor) from Sacramento, CA, USA on Nov 25 2009.
- to not pay attention.
We can't trust him to watch the line because he's always got his head up his ass.
